Moving through the corridors and bowels of an enormous and disorientating structure, the camera takes the viewer on a descent down to a dehumanised place of physical labour and intense hardship. This gigantic textile factory in Gujarat, India becomes a 21st century equivalent of Dante’s Inferno. Director Rahul Jain observes the life of the workers, the suffering and the environment they can hardly escape from with thoughtful intimacy. With strong visual language, memorable images and carefully selected interviews of the workers themselves, Jain tells a story of inequality, oppression and the huge divide between rich, poor, and the perspectives of both.
